일반/일거리

통신사 WIFI 유료 결제

림쌍월 2021. 1. 19. 23:00

-개발환경

 윈도우 

 

-개발도구

 VI editor

 

-개발기술및 언어

 Ajax , jsp

 

-개발내용

 지금도 대부분 각 통신사 마다 유료 WIFI 결제를 통해서 타 통신사사용자에게 무선 WIFI통신망을 이용할수 있도록 지원을 해준다. 2009년인가 2010년도였던거 같다. 기본적인 화면이나 퍼블리싱은 전부 완료가 된 상태에서 최소한의 기능만으로 가입부터 결제까지 구현해야 된다는 내용이었었으며 단일페이지에서 대부분의 모든 기능을 축약해서 개발을 완료 하라는 미션이 있는 프로젝트였다.

 

 지금 생각해보니 이런걸 SPA라고 지금은 말해도 되겠다.

 

 모바일에서만 접속할수 있었으며 해당 통신사의 회원은 따로 가입및 결제 로직이 보여지지도 않으며 사용자 관리에 거의 필수다 싶이 하는 아이디 , 비번찾기도 없었던것 같다 .

 대신 반드시 스마트폰을 통한 모바일 접속만 허용하고 그외의 모든 접속 환경에서는 접속을 허용하지 않았으며 가입부터 결제 관련 모든 중요정보는 핸드폰인증을 통한 SMS로 처리를 해주었기에 당시로서는 조금 이색적이기도 했었다.

 

웹으로 프로젝트를 하면서 비통기통신 (Async) 를 자바스크립트로 구현하는 것이 얼마나 효율이 떨어 지며 생산속도가 느린지를 뼈져리게 느꼈던 프로젝트이기도 하다. 고객사의 요청으로 추가적인 어떠한 라이브러리나 프로그램을 사용해서는 않된다는 큰 제약이 있어서 흔한디 흔한 jQuery 조차도 사용할수가 없었다. 그래서 VI editor 와 자바스크립트로만

노가다성 코딩을 개발을 했었었다.

 

 VI editor는 또 얼마나 손에 익지 않아서 거지같았던지 물론 지금도 여전히 좋아하지는 않는다.